Behind The Lens

Location

This photo was taken in my living room. I converted it into a photography studio for the day!

Time

Late at night. You can shoot anytime in the studio!

Lighting

There are two strobes camera right. One with a 22” beauty dish lighting my subject, the other with yellow and amber gels lighting the background.

Equipment

My Pentax K-70 with the HD f/2.8 24-70 mm lens. I used a tripod and two strobes. There was also a white backdrop on a backdrop stand.

Inspiration

I took this photo of my daughter after watching Lindsey Adler’s Learn+ episode on Color. I chose a triad from my color wheel based off the dress. Then I chose the background gels and her makeup color to complete the triad of colors. I love color so this was so much fun to plan and shoot!

Editing

Yes. I processed this image in both Lightroom and photoshop.

In my camera bag

I typically carry 4 speed lites with batteries. My 35 mm prime macro lens a light meter, a color passport.

Feedback

Be intentional with the color palette you choose. Whether it’s a triad, monochromatic, complimentary, etc. I intentionally chose a triad first. Then start with something you have and fill in the rest. I have tons of colors for gels and makeup. So I started with the dress that we had and chose the makeup and background colors that would create the triad for the dress color.
